Birthdate: April 22, 1920
Sun Sign: Taurus
Birthplace: San Francisco, California, United States
Died: January 19, 1970
Hal March, an American comedian and actor, was best known for his role as the emcee of the widely popular quiz show “The $64,000 Question” during the 1950s. His charm, quick humor, and engaging hosting style endeared him to audiences and contestants alike. March’s legacy as a talented and versatile entertainer is rooted in his significant contributions to television and comedy, leaving a lasting impact on the entertainment industry.
